Summary
365 Data Centers, a leading provider of network-centric colocation, network, cloud, and managed services, has announced a transformative partnership with Robot Network to deliver innovative private cloud AI solutions for enterprise customers. This groundbreaking collaboration introduces an entirely new infrastructure pattern where colocation facilities become the optimization layer for artificial intelligence. Hosted in 365's cloud infrastructure, the new Robot capability will support small-language models, analytics, reporting, business intelligence, custom capabilities, and cost optimization, creating a revolutionary approach to AI deployment that fundamentally changes how businesses leverage artificial intelligence technology.
The partnership builds on 365's strong foundation in colocation, network, and cloud services, creating a fusion of infrastructure and AI that enables intelligent operations at the edge. This innovative system handles more than 90% of workloads entirely within the data center, leveraging high-density AI at the cores only for the remaining few percent that demand it. The result is a new class of hybrid AI infrastructure that transforms colocation from passive hosting into an active optimization layer, significantly reducing total AI operating costs while enabling agentic AI to run securely within 10-50 kW footprints. This approach dramatically increases revenue per watt for colocation and data centers, representing a major advancement in efficiency and performance.
Derek Gillespie, CEO of 365 Data Centers, emphasized that their objective is to meet AI where colocation, connectivity and cloud converge, providing seamless integration and economies of scale for customers and partners. The joint offering introduces initial use cases for enterprise clients through a proprietary AI chat platform that integrates small and large language models to revolutionize AI adoption. Jacob Guedalia, CEO of Robot Network, highlighted that their system harnesses small AI models from market-leading firms including Meta, OpenAI, and Grok to make advanced AI accessible and affordable for millions of enterprises.
